Key responsibilities:

 •  Transporting patients throughout the hospital; ensuring response times and standards are maintained throughout.
 •  Delivering medical gas cylinders, equipment, stores, furniture, pharmaceutical and pathology items.
 •  Taking blood samples, specimens and medication around the hospital in a timely and pleasant manner.
 •  To take linen, case notes and the removal and disposal of waste.
 •  Transporting the deceased to the mortuary.
 •  Receive, record and prioritise job requests in line with agreed procedures.
 •  Support medical staff during emergency situations.
